Amy Rheingans, Director of Youth and Children’s Music

send e-mail

I grew up in Northern Illinois and moved to the Portland area in 1995. Soon after that, I began working at Valley.  In addition to my work at Valley, I work as an elementary music teacher at Oregon Episcopal School. 

I am married to Thomas Rheingans, a professional pianist and music teacher. We have two beautiful children. In May 2003, our daughter, Jacqueline, was born and in May 2005, our son, Samuel, was born.

At Valley, I direct the Valley Academy of Performing Arts (VAPA) and handle administrative and teaching responsibilities for the following:

  • Vocal and handbell choirs for children and youth
  • Youth drama
  • Summer Performing Arts camps
  • Sunday school music

Darlene Cusick, Organist

After earning a Bachelor’s degree in Music from Lewis and Clark College and a Master’s degree from the University of Washington, I worked as the Assistant Organist at the First Presbyterian Church in Portland for 16 years. I have been at Valley for 11 years now as the Organist. My husband, Bob, and I -- both native Portlanders -- have three children.

In addition to teaching piano and performing, I also enjoy walking, biking, and cooking.
